The museum in Newark, N.J. has announced its Summer Session camp will return to offer youth ages 13 to 18 an opportunity to gain tools needed to embark on a career in the music industry. JAZZ FEST 2021 RESCHEDULED FOR OCTOBER 8-17 New Orleans, LA (January 19, 2021) — Due to the ongoing Covid-19 pandemic, the producers of the New Orleans Jazz & Heritage Festival presented by Shell have decided to postpone this year’s event until the fall. With 12 stages of music and an alumni list that stretches past 22,000 performers since 1970, Jazz Fest has hosted some of the greatest artists of the last half century. In March 2018, the Recording Academy established a third-party task force to examine issues of diversity and inclusion within the Academy and the broader music community.
